Requirements

  • Hold a bachelor's degree in Electrical, Mechanical, or Chemical Engineering, or a related field.
  • Have deployed and commissioned control systems on industrial or mission-critical facilities with hands-on accountability for live system startup and acceptance.
  • Have programmed and configured PLCs, SCADA, or HMI systems on at least one major platform (Rockwell, Siemens, Ignition, or equivalent).
  • Have troubleshot control system integration failures and loop errors independently during active commissioning.
  • Can travel to deployment and operations sites up to 50 percent of the time.

Responsibilities

  • Deploy and commission BMS, SCADA, and EPMS systems at data center sites, running FAT, field integration, loop checks, sequence verification, and acceptance testing through to live handover.
  • Support operational reliability of deployed control systems, responding to alerts and failures on live infrastructure and implementing fixes that prevent recurrence.
  • Resolve field integration issues between control system layers and connected mechanical and electrical systems during commissioning, escalating with a clear problem description and proposed fix.
  • Configure and verify control sequences, alarm setpoints, and data historian integrations against operational requirements.
  • Contribute to commissioning checklists, acceptance test procedures, and runbooks that speed up and standardize future deployments.
